Section 5D. The department shall make such rules and regulations concerning labeling, thickness and methods of use of plastic bags and plastic film as it shall deem necessary for the protection of the lives and safety of the public, which rules and regulations may provide penalties for the violation thereof not exceeding five hundred dollars for any one offence.
